What is the Common Data Set 2?
The Common Data Set (CDS) serves as a standardized format utilized by educational institutions for systematic data collection. Its primary purpose is to gather critical information on enrollment statistics, admissions processes, and student demographics. This form is commonly used across various types of institutions, including colleges, universities, and community colleges. By adopting the common data set 2, institutions can streamline enrollment data reporting and ensure consistency across their data collection efforts.
